What companies run services between Totteridge & Whetstone Station, England and Colindale Station, England?

You can take a subway from Totteridge & Whetstone station to Colindale station via Camden Town station in around 40 min. Alternatively, First Bus London operates a bus from Whetstone High Road / Friern Barnet Lane to Colindale Station every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 35 min.
